    Hi,
    Upgrading graphics chips on laptops is very difficult and mostly impossible because the chips are soldered to the motherboard. You can upgrade the graphics chip by replacing the motherboard with a compatible one which has a more powerful graphics chip. In your case it is a mobo with an Nvidia GF GT650M with 2GB of DDR5 RAM. However, the motherboard costs approx $600. The part number you need is:  682040-001.
    It looks like M7series laptops are compatible with Dv7-6000 series laptops. See a service manual:

  • Can you upgrade the RAM on a Retina Display Macbook Pro?

    So I've been looking around for information on whether the RAM on a Retina Macbook Pro can be upgraded and the mixed messages have left me confused. If I take my Macbook Pro (Retina Display) to an Apple store for a RAM upgrade and offer to pay them for the RAM and installation, would they do it for me?
    Thanks and if you can't, please explain why.
    I am aware that the RAM is soldered into the motherboard making it very difficult to perform the upgrade, but will some stores actually do it for you?

    The MacBook Pro with Retina display is soldered onto the logic board, so RAM can't be added without replacing the logic board.
    I know there are shops that may try to add more RAM without replacing the logic board, but they aren't official resellers and if something happens, the warranty will be voided. Apple won't do it.
    If you want, you can sell your MacBook Pro and get another one with more RAM. It's the best way to do it, because I don't think you want to spend a lot of money replacing the logic board or you want to take it to a non-official technical support, putting the Mac in risk

  • Can you do the Java equivalent of this with Generics?

    hi,
    http://www.informit.com/content/index.asp?product_id=%7B4BCD9193-97E4-4004-AF84-D7346E261C69%7D
    thanks,
    asjf

    Think of specialization as "compile-time" polymorphism. It allows you to create different implementations of methods/classes for different types, selected at compile-time. For example, I use template specialization extensively in Jace to unify entire sets of type-disparate JNI functions.
    Specialization is a very powerful technique and is also used extensively in template meta-programming (which brings us back to the OP). Even were the current form of Java generics to somehow magically support some form of specialization, you still wouldn't be able to perform meta-programming as Java generics don't work with constants.
    Any surface similarities between Java generics and C++ templates expire at trivial inspection, which means that it's a fairly futile exercise to try to compare the two.
